Hereditary peers claim nearly £500,000 in expenses during the pandemic

Hereditary peers have claimed nearly £500,000 in expenses during the pandemic as unprecedented numbers turned out to vote remotely. The 85 Lords who hold titles because of their birthright claimed £484,000 from the taxpayer between April and October last year.
